Islip Train Schedule - Long Island Railroad

TIP: If you do not see a direct route from your location, try clicking a trip's origin station to search for a connecting transfer.
Date:

Jamaica to Patchogue -
Arrives in Islip at 4:00 PM

Babylon to Patchogue -
Arrives in Islip at 4:38 PM

Babylon to Speonk -
Arrives in Islip at 5:26 PM

Hunterspoint Avenue to Montauk -
Arrives in Islip at 5:40 PM

Long Island City to Patchogue -
Arrives in Islip at 5:52 PM

Penn Station to Speonk -
Arrives in Islip at 6:26 PM

Babylon to Patchogue -
Arrives in Islip at 6:49 PM

Jamaica to Montauk -
Arrives in Islip at 7:25 PM

Penn Station to Speonk -
Arrives in Islip at 7:41 PM

Babylon to Speonk -
Arrives in Islip at 8:47 PM

Jamaica to Montauk -
Arrives in Islip at 9:39 PM

Babylon to Patchogue -
Arrives in Islip at 10:47 PM

Jamaica to Speonk -
Arrives in Islip at 11:44 PM

Patchogue to Babylon -
Arrives in Islip at 3:53 PM

Speonk to Jamaica -
Arrives in Islip at 5:03 PM

Patchogue to Babylon -
Arrives in Islip at 5:51 PM

Patchogue to Babylon -
Arrives in Islip at 6:51 PM

Patchogue to Babylon -
Arrives in Islip at 7:51 PM

Speonk to Jamaica -
Arrives in Islip at 9:57 PM

Speonk to Jamaica -
Arrives in Islip at 10:51 PM

Patchogue to Jamaica -
Arrives in Islip at 11:49 PM